Description: Our Gene-specific Break Apart Probes usually target the flanks of the target gene (CST9). Due to this design method, our probe products can detect chromosomal rearrangements, such as translocations, by FISH.The product usually consists of a reagent combination composed of a probe with a selected dye color and a hybridization reagent.
Application: CST9 Gene-specific Break Apart Probe is designed to detect potential CST9 rearrangements. This probe has been confirmed on the metaphase and interphase chromosomes by FISH. Gene Details

Gene Name Cystatin 9
Gene Summary [Provided by RefSeq] The cystatin superfamily encompasses proteins that contain multiple cystatin-like sequences. Some of the members are active cysteine protease inhibitors, while others have lost or perhaps never acquired this inhibitory activity. There are three inhibitory families in the superfamily, including the type 1 cystatins (stefins), type 2 cystatins and the kininogens. The type 2 cystatin proteins are a class of cysteine proteinase inhibitors found in a variety of human fluids and secretions, where they appear to provide protective functions. The cystatin locus on chromosome 20 contains the majority of the type 2 cystatin genes and pseudogenes. This gene is located in the cystatin locus and encodes a secreted protein that may play a role in hematopoietic differentiation or inflammation. [provided by RefSeq, Jul 2008]
Gene Symbol CST9
Location 20p11.21
Chromosome Chromosome20
Coordinates This gene maps to 23583046-23586610 in GRCh37 coordinates.
